The writing could be repetitive and I kept getting bored with the physical book so I switched to an abridged audiobook because I simply couldn’t focus. I did start to enjoy the book more with the audiobook so changing the format (and having all the repetitive pages skipped) made a huge difference to my enjoyment and raised my rating! I did enjoy the second half much better than the first.

Margaret is unbearable 😓
As a historical figure, she’s intriguing and I want to learn more about her. However the book character is irritating and extremely unlikeable-She’s holier than thou and has a lot of internalized misogyny towards Elizabeth. She’s also quite greedy and power hungry despite saying how pious she is. I can understand where she’s coming from, and her loyalty and determination are admirable at times!

My favorite of the series (so far) is still The Lady of the Rivers! I’m hoping the MCs become more likeable as the series continues because I haven’t cared for Margaret or Elizabeth Woodville
